The Role
Reporting into the Health & Safety Manager, you will work closely with site and project teams to drive best practice and ensure compliance across multiple live construction projects.
This role offers excellent exposure to a variety of project types and a genuine pathway for career progression into a Senior Health & Safety Advisor or management position.
Key Responsibilities
• Conduct regular site inspections and health & safety audits.
• Advise site management teams on health & safety best practice and legislative requirements.
• Support the review and implementation of RAMS.
• Assist with incident and accident investigations, identifying root causes and lessons learned.
• Produce audit reports and monitor close-out of actions.
• Deliver toolbox talks and engage with site teams to promote a positive safety culture.
• Monitor subcontractor compliance and performance.
• Support the ongoing development of the company’s health & safety systems and procedures.
• Build positive relationships with operational teams and stakeholders across the business.
